Documentation ¶
Index ¶
- Variables
- type WebApiService
- func (ws *WebApiService) AddICECandidate(ctx context.Context, request *v1.AddICECandidateRequest) (*v1.AddICECandidateResponse, error)
- func (ws *WebApiService) CreateMacro(ctx context.Context, request *v1.CreateMacroRequest) (*v1.CreateMacroResponse, error)
- func (ws *WebApiService) CreateRoom(ctx context.Context, request *v1.CreateRoomRequest) (*v1.CreateRoomResponse, error)
- func (ws *WebApiService) CreateUserKeyboardBinding(ctx context.Context, request *v1.CreateUserKeyboardBindingRequest) (*v1.CreateUserKeyboardBindingResponse, error)
- func (ws *WebApiService) DeleteMacro(ctx context.Context, request *v1.DeleteMacroRequest) (*v1.DeleteMacroResponse, error)
- func (ws *WebApiService) DeleteMember(ctx context.Context, request *v1.DeleteMemberRequest) (*v1.DeleteMemberResponse, error)
- func (ws *WebApiService) DeleteRoom(ctx context.Context, request *v1.DeleteRoomRequest) (*v1.DeleteRoomResponse, error)
- func (ws *WebApiService) DeleteSave(ctx context.Context, request *v1.DeleteSaveRequest) (*v1.DeleteSaveResponse, error)
- func (ws *WebApiService) DeleteUserKeyboardBinding(ctx context.Context, request *v1.DeleteUserKeyboardBindingRequest) (*v1.DeleteUserKeyboardBindingResponse, error)
- func (ws *WebApiService) GetEmulatorSpeed(ctx context.Context, request *v1.GetEmulatorSpeedRequest) (*v1.GetEmulatorSpeedResponse, error)
- func (ws *WebApiService) GetGraphicOptions(ctx context.Context, request *v1.GetGraphicOptionsRequest) (*v1.GetGraphicOptionsResponse, error)
- func (ws *WebApiService) GetMacro(ctx context.Context, request *v1.GetMacroRequest) (*v1.GetMacroResponse, error)
- func (ws *WebApiService) GetRoom(ctx context.Context, request *v1.GetRoomRequest) (*v1.GetRoomResponse, error)
- func (ws *WebApiService) GetRoomMember(ctx context.Context, request *v1.GetRoomMemberRequest) (*v1.GetRoomMemberResponse, error)
- func (ws *WebApiService) GetServerICECandidate(ctx context.Context, request *v1.GetServerICECandidateRequest) (*v1.GetServerICECandidateResponse, error)
- func (ws *WebApiService) GetUser(ctx context.Context, request *v1.GetUserRequest) (*v1.GetUserResponse, error)
- func (ws *WebApiService) GetUserKeyboardBinding(ctx context.Context, request *v1.GetUserKeyboardBindingRequest) (*v1.GetUserKeyboardBindingResponse, error)
- func (ws *WebApiService) JoinRoom(ctx context.Context, request *v1.JoinRoomRequest) (*v1.JoinRoomResponse, error)
- func (ws *WebApiService) ListAllRooms(ctx context.Context, request *v1.ListRoomRequest) (*v1.ListRoomResponse, error)
- func (ws *WebApiService) ListGames(ctx context.Context, _ *v1.ListGamesRequest) (*v1.ListGamesResponse, error)
- func (ws *WebApiService) ListMacro(ctx context.Context, request *v1.ListMacroRequest) (*v1.ListMacroResponse, error)
- func (ws *WebApiService) ListMembers(ctx context.Context, request *v1.ListMemberRequest) (*v1.ListMemberResponse, error)
- func (ws *WebApiService) ListMyRooms(ctx context.Context, request *v1.ListRoomRequest) (*v1.ListRoomResponse, error)
- func (ws *WebApiService) ListSaves(ctx context.Context, request *v1.ListSavesRequest) (*v1.ListSavesResponse, error)
- func (ws *WebApiService) ListSupportedEmulators(ctx context.Context, request *v1.ListSupportedEmulatorsRequest) (*v1.ListSupportedEmulatorsResponse, error)
- func (ws *WebApiService) ListUserKeyboardBinding(ctx context.Context, request *v1.ListUserKeyboardBindingRequest) (*v1.ListUserKeyboardBindingResponse, error)
- func (ws *WebApiService) LoadSave(ctx context.Context, request *v1.LoadSaveRequest) (*v1.LoadSaveResponse, error)
- func (ws *WebApiService) Login(ctx context.Context, request *v1.LoginRequest) (*v1.LoginResponse, error)
- func (ws *WebApiService) OpenGameConnection(ctx context.Context, request *v1.OpenGameConnectionRequest) (*v1.OpenGameConnectionResponse, error)
- func (ws *WebApiService) Register(ctx context.Context, request *v1.RegisterRequest) (*v1.RegisterResponse, error)
- func (ws *WebApiService) RestartEmulator(ctx context.Context, request *v1.RestartEmulatorRequest) (*v1.RestartEmulatorResponse, error)
- func (ws *WebApiService) SDPAnswer(ctx context.Context, request *v1.SDPAnswerRequest) (*v1.SDPAnswerResponse, error)
- func (ws *WebApiService) SaveGame(ctx context.Context, request *v1.SaveGameRequest) (*v1.SaveGameResponse, error)
- func (ws *WebApiService) SetController(ctx context.Context, request *v1.SetControllerRequest) (*v1.SetControllerResponse, error)
- func (ws *WebApiService) SetEmulatorSpeed(ctx context.Context, request *v1.SetEmulatorSpeedRequest) (*v1.SetEmulatorSpeedResponse, error)
- func (ws *WebApiService) SetGraphicOptions(ctx context.Context, request *v1.SetGraphicOptionsRequest) (*v1.SetGraphicOptionsResponse, error)
- func (ws *WebApiService) UpdateMemberRole(ctx context.Context, request *v1.UpdateMemberRoleRequest) (*v1.UpdateMemberRoleResponse, error)
- func (ws *WebApiService) UpdateRoom(ctx context.Context, request *v1.UpdateRoomRequest) (*v1.UpdateRoomResponse, error)
- func (ws *WebApiService) UpdateUserKeyboardBinding(ctx context.Context, request *v1.UpdateUserKeyboardBindingRequest) (*v1.UpdateUserKeyboardBindingResponse, error)
Constants ¶
This section is empty.
Variables ¶
View Source
var ProviderSet = wire.NewSet(NewWebApiService)
ProviderSet is service providers.
Functions ¶
This section is empty.
Types ¶
type WebApiService ¶
type WebApiService struct { v1.UnimplementedWebApiServer // contains filtered or unexported fields }
func NewWebApiService ¶
func NewWebApiService(uc *biz.UserUseCase, ac *biz.AuthUseCase, rc *biz.RoomUseCase, gc *biz.GamingUseCase, uk *biz.UserKeyboardBindingUseCase, mu *biz.MacroUseCase, logger log.Logger) *WebApiService
func (*WebApiService) AddICECandidate ¶
func (ws *WebApiService) AddICECandidate(ctx context.Context, request *v1.AddICECandidateRequest) (*v1.AddICECandidateResponse, error)
func (*WebApiService) CreateMacro ¶
func (ws *WebApiService) CreateMacro(ctx context.Context, request *v1.CreateMacroRequest) (*v1.CreateMacroResponse, error)
func (*WebApiService) CreateRoom ¶
func (ws *WebApiService) CreateRoom(ctx context.Context, request *v1.CreateRoomRequest) (*v1.CreateRoomResponse, error)
func (*WebApiService) CreateUserKeyboardBinding ¶
func (ws *WebApiService) CreateUserKeyboardBinding(ctx context.Context, request *v1.CreateUserKeyboardBindingRequest) (*v1.CreateUserKeyboardBindingResponse, error)
func (*WebApiService) DeleteMacro ¶
func (ws *WebApiService) DeleteMacro(ctx context.Context, request *v1.DeleteMacroRequest) (*v1.DeleteMacroResponse, error)
func (*WebApiService) DeleteMember ¶
func (ws *WebApiService) DeleteMember(ctx context.Context, request *v1.DeleteMemberRequest) (*v1.DeleteMemberResponse, error)
func (*WebApiService) DeleteRoom ¶
func (ws *WebApiService) DeleteRoom(ctx context.Context, request *v1.DeleteRoomRequest) (*v1.DeleteRoomResponse, error)
func (*WebApiService) DeleteSave ¶
func (ws *WebApiService) DeleteSave(ctx context.Context, request *v1.DeleteSaveRequest) (*v1.DeleteSaveResponse, error)
func (*WebApiService) DeleteUserKeyboardBinding ¶
func (ws *WebApiService) DeleteUserKeyboardBinding(ctx context.Context, request *v1.DeleteUserKeyboardBindingRequest) (*v1.DeleteUserKeyboardBindingResponse, error)
func (*WebApiService) GetEmulatorSpeed ¶
func (ws *WebApiService) GetEmulatorSpeed(ctx context.Context, request *v1.GetEmulatorSpeedRequest) (*v1.GetEmulatorSpeedResponse, error)
func (*WebApiService) GetGraphicOptions ¶
func (ws *WebApiService) GetGraphicOptions(ctx context.Context, request *v1.GetGraphicOptionsRequest) (*v1.GetGraphicOptionsResponse, error)
func (*WebApiService) GetMacro ¶
func (ws *WebApiService) GetMacro(ctx context.Context, request *v1.GetMacroRequest) (*v1.GetMacroResponse, error)
func (*WebApiService) GetRoom ¶
func (ws *WebApiService) GetRoom(ctx context.Context, request *v1.GetRoomRequest) (*v1.GetRoomResponse, error)
func (*WebApiService) GetRoomMember ¶
func (ws *WebApiService) GetRoomMember(ctx context.Context, request *v1.GetRoomMemberRequest) (*v1.GetRoomMemberResponse, error)
func (*WebApiService) GetServerICECandidate ¶
func (ws *WebApiService) GetServerICECandidate(ctx context.Context, request *v1.GetServerICECandidateRequest) (*v1.GetServerICECandidateResponse, error)
func (*WebApiService) GetUser ¶
func (ws *WebApiService) GetUser(ctx context.Context, request *v1.GetUserRequest) (*v1.GetUserResponse, error)
func (*WebApiService) GetUserKeyboardBinding ¶
func (ws *WebApiService) GetUserKeyboardBinding(ctx context.Context, request *v1.GetUserKeyboardBindingRequest) (*v1.GetUserKeyboardBindingResponse, error)
func (*WebApiService) JoinRoom ¶
func (ws *WebApiService) JoinRoom(ctx context.Context, request *v1.JoinRoomRequest) (*v1.JoinRoomResponse, error)
func (*WebApiService) ListAllRooms ¶
func (ws *WebApiService) ListAllRooms(ctx context.Context, request *v1.ListRoomRequest) (*v1.ListRoomResponse, error)
func (*WebApiService) ListGames ¶
func (ws *WebApiService) ListGames(ctx context.Context, _ *v1.ListGamesRequest) (*v1.ListGamesResponse, error)
func (*WebApiService) ListMacro ¶
func (ws *WebApiService) ListMacro(ctx context.Context, request *v1.ListMacroRequest) (*v1.ListMacroResponse, error)
func (*WebApiService) ListMembers ¶
func (ws *WebApiService) ListMembers(ctx context.Context, request *v1.ListMemberRequest) (*v1.ListMemberResponse, error)
func (*WebApiService) ListMyRooms ¶
func (ws *WebApiService) ListMyRooms(ctx context.Context, request *v1.ListRoomRequest) (*v1.ListRoomResponse, error)
func (*WebApiService) ListSaves ¶
func (ws *WebApiService) ListSaves(ctx context.Context, request *v1.ListSavesRequest) (*v1.ListSavesResponse, error)
func (*WebApiService) ListSupportedEmulators ¶
func (ws *WebApiService) ListSupportedEmulators(ctx context.Context, request *v1.ListSupportedEmulatorsRequest) (*v1.ListSupportedEmulatorsResponse, error)
func (*WebApiService) ListUserKeyboardBinding ¶
func (ws *WebApiService) ListUserKeyboardBinding(ctx context.Context, request *v1.ListUserKeyboardBindingRequest) (*v1.ListUserKeyboardBindingResponse, error)
func (*WebApiService) LoadSave ¶
func (ws *WebApiService) LoadSave(ctx context.Context, request *v1.LoadSaveRequest) (*v1.LoadSaveResponse, error)
func (*WebApiService) Login ¶
func (ws *WebApiService) Login(ctx context.Context, request *v1.LoginRequest) (*v1.LoginResponse, error)
func (*WebApiService) OpenGameConnection ¶
func (ws *WebApiService) OpenGameConnection(ctx context.Context, request *v1.OpenGameConnectionRequest) (*v1.OpenGameConnectionResponse, error)
func (*WebApiService) Register ¶
func (ws *WebApiService) Register(ctx context.Context, request *v1.RegisterRequest) (*v1.RegisterResponse, error)
func (*WebApiService) RestartEmulator ¶
func (ws *WebApiService) RestartEmulator(ctx context.Context, request *v1.RestartEmulatorRequest) (*v1.RestartEmulatorResponse, error)
func (*WebApiService) SDPAnswer ¶
func (ws *WebApiService) SDPAnswer(ctx context.Context, request *v1.SDPAnswerRequest) (*v1.SDPAnswerResponse, error)
func (*WebApiService) SaveGame ¶
func (ws *WebApiService) SaveGame(ctx context.Context, request *v1.SaveGameRequest) (*v1.SaveGameResponse, error)
func (*WebApiService) SetController ¶
func (ws *WebApiService) SetController(ctx context.Context, request *v1.SetControllerRequest) (*v1.SetControllerResponse, error)
func (*WebApiService) SetEmulatorSpeed ¶
func (ws *WebApiService) SetEmulatorSpeed(ctx context.Context, request *v1.SetEmulatorSpeedRequest) (*v1.SetEmulatorSpeedResponse, error)
func (*WebApiService) SetGraphicOptions ¶
func (ws *WebApiService) SetGraphicOptions(ctx context.Context, request *v1.SetGraphicOptionsRequest) (*v1.SetGraphicOptionsResponse, error)
func (*WebApiService) UpdateMemberRole ¶
func (ws *WebApiService) UpdateMemberRole(ctx context.Context, request *v1.UpdateMemberRoleRequest) (*v1.UpdateMemberRoleResponse, error)
func (*WebApiService) UpdateRoom ¶
func (ws *WebApiService) UpdateRoom(ctx context.Context, request *v1.UpdateRoomRequest) (*v1.UpdateRoomResponse, error)
func (*WebApiService) UpdateUserKeyboardBinding ¶
func (ws *WebApiService) UpdateUserKeyboardBinding(ctx context.Context, request *v1.UpdateUserKeyboardBindingRequest) (*v1.UpdateUserKeyboardBindingResponse, error)
Click to show internal directories.
Click to hide internal directories.